A New Solo Exhibition Opens in Kala Ghoda

The Institute of Contemporary Indian Art (ICIA) is set to present #EveryDayIsCheatDay, a solo exhibition by contemporary artist Suryakant Lokhande, on view at the ICIA Gallery from 9 to 14 February 2026. 

A Theatrical World of Pleasure and Excess

In this new body of work, Lokhande constructs a vividly theatrical universe where pleasure, nostalgia, and ambition collide. Familiar cartoon figures emerge as protagonists in scenes shaped by wealth, conquest, leisure, and indulgence. 

Cartoon Characters as Cultural Masks

Detached from their original narratives, these figures operate as cultural masks rather than innocent icons. They inhabit symbolic landscapes of gold, luxury, and fantasy, evoking collective memory while reflecting contemporary human behaviour. 

Abundance as Atmosphere, Not Achievement

Rather than celebrating prosperity, Lokhande presents abundance as routine. Excess becomes an everyday condition, where indulgence is no longer exceptional but a constant atmosphere within modern life. 

Looping Spectacle and Quiet Tension

The characters appear perpetually engaged—collecting, posing, resting, and celebrating—yet their actions feel suspended in repetition. This theatrical stasis suggests an underlying tension between spectacle and emptiness. 

Nostalgia Meets Adult Economies of Desire

A key element of the exhibition is the unsettling collision of childhood cartoon innocence with adult economies of aspiration and desire. Lokhande’s imagery balances playfulness with subtle control and exhaustion beneath the surface. 

An Artist Examining Power, Desire, and Spectacle

Suryakant Lokhande is known for blending popular visual culture with painterly realism to explore themes of power, aspiration, and spectacle. His practice draws from mass media and theatrical staging, making him a significant voice in Indian contemporary art today. 

Artist Statement on the Exhibition

Speaking about the show, Lokhande notes that his work uses cartoon figures to explore wealth, fantasy, and everyday life, where happiness becomes a staged performance and indulgence turns routine. 

Exhibition Details

Aspects Details
Exhibition Title #EveryDayIsCheatDay
Artist Suryakant Lokhande
Presented By Institute of Contemporary Indian Art (ICIA)
Dates 9th to 14th February, 2026
Venue The ICIA Gallery, Kala Ghoda
Theme Desire, wealth, nostalgia, spectacle, and contemporary consumption

Takeaway

With #EveryDayIsCheatDay, Lokhande reflects the logic of contemporary consumption back to viewers through exaggeration, nostalgia, and visual excess. The exhibition presents modern life as a stage where pleasure is endlessly rehearsed—abundant, performative, and quietly unresolved.
